Public Consultation on Draft Ballycullen-Oldcourt Area Plan

The Ballycullen-Oldcourt Lands (125 hectares) stretch across the foothills of the Dublin Mountains and form a buffer between the suburban areas of Tallaght, Firhouse and Knocklyon with the Dublin Mountains. While development has commenced on the eastern side of this suburban fringe, over 90 Hectares of zoned lands still remain undeveloped and there are a number of sensitivities in relation to Green Infrastructure and the amenities of the Dublin Mountains.

Following on from pre-draft public consultation carried out over a four week period between April and May 2013, South Dublin County Council has prepared a Draft Local Area Plan (see accompanying Plan Illustration) and is undertaking consultation from Friday 18th October 2013 to Thursday 28th November 2013 (inclusive). This draft consultation provides further opportunity for local ideas to be heard and taken into consideration before the Local Area Plan is made.

The proposed Local Area Plan and Environmental Reports (Strategic Environmental Assessment Report and Appropriate Assessment Screening) can be viewed on the Council’s website at www.sdublincoco.ie and can also be viewed at County Library (Tallaght), County Hall (Tallaght) and at the new Park Community Centre (Ballycragh Park), during normal opening hours.
